Psalm 119:174

I have longed for thy salvation, O LORD; and thy law is my delight.

Psalm 119:16

I will delight myself in thy statutes: I will not forget thy word.

Psalm 119:24

Thy testimonies also are my delight and my counsellers.

Genesis 49:18

I have waited for thy salvation, O LORD.

2 Samuel 23:5

Although my house be not so with God; yet he hath made with me an everlasting covenant, ordered in all things, and sure: for this is all my salvation, and all my desire, although he make it not to grow.

Psalm 1:2

But his delight is in the law of the LORD; and in his law doth he meditate day and night.

Psalm 119:47

And I will delight myself in thy commandments, which I have loved.

Psalm 119:77

Let thy tender mercies come unto me, that I may live: for thy law is my delight.

Psalm 119:81

CAPH. My soul fainteth for thy salvation: but I hope in thy word.

Psalm 119:111

Thy testimonies have I taken as an heritage for ever: for they are the rejoicing of my heart.

Psalm 119:162

I rejoice at thy word, as one that findeth great spoil.

Psalm 119:166-167

LORD, I have hoped for thy salvation, and done thy commandments.

Proverbs 13:12

Hope deferred maketh the heart sick: but when the desire cometh, it is a tree of life.

Song of Songs 5:8

I charge you, O daughters of Jerusalem, if ye find my beloved, that ye tell him, that I am sick of love.

Romans 7:22-25

For I delight in the law of God after the inward man:

Romans 8:23-25

And not only they, but ourselves also, which have the firstfruits of the Spirit, even we ourselves groan within ourselves, waiting for the adoption, to wit, the redemption of our body.

Philippians 1:23

For I am in a strait betwixt two, having a desire to depart, and to be with Christ; which is far better:
